A bakery orders 6 1/2 pounds of gluten-free flour. Each gluten-free cake uses 3/4 pound of the special flour. How many full cakes can the bakery make from this order? Your answer should be a whole number.(1 point)

To find the number of full cakes the bakery can make, divide the total amount of gluten-free flour by the amount used per cake: 6.5 pounds / 0.75 pounds/cake = <<6.5/0.75=8.666666666666666>>8 full cakes. Answer: \boxed{8}.
